Convertir JSON en XML en ligne — conversion de format de données gratuite

Convertir JSON en XML gratuitement avec EnConvert. Transformer des données d'API REST en XML pour systèmes d'entreprise et services SOAP. Sans inscription. API développeur disponible.

Cliquez pour téléverser ou glissez-déposez

Formats acceptés : JSON
Résultat

Comment convertir JSON en XML

1

Uploader votre fichier JSON

Cliquez sur la zone d'upload ou glissez-déposez votre fichier .json. EnConvert accepte les fichiers JSON jusqu'à 5 Mo sur l'offre gratuite. Votre fichier est traité de manière sécurisée et supprimé après conversion.

2

Convertir JSON en XML

EnConvert transforme votre JSON en XML bien formé avec imbrication d'éléments appropriée, typage de données et encodage UTF-8. La sortie est du XML valide prêt pour systèmes d'entreprise et APIs SOAP.

3

Télécharger votre fichier XML

Votre XML converti est prêt instantanément. Cliquez sur le bouton de téléchargement pour sauvegarder le fichier. Les liens de téléchargement restent actifs 1 heure sur l'offre gratuite.

Pourquoi convertir JSON en XML ?

JSON est le standard des APIs REST modernes, mais beaucoup de systèmes d'entreprise, applications legacy et standards industriels requièrent encore XML. Convertir JSON en XML fait le pont entre services web modernes et infrastructure d'entreprise traditionnelle.

Intégration de systèmes d'entreprise et legacy. Les services web SOAP, systèmes ERP et beaucoup d'échanges de données gouvernementaux et de santé requièrent XML. Si votre application produit du JSON mais doit communiquer avec ces systèmes, la conversion JSON-vers-XML est le pont.

Conformité aux standards industriels. Les industries régulées utilisent des standards basés sur XML : HL7 pour la santé, XBRL pour le reporting financier et ONIX pour l'édition. Convertir des données JSON en XML est nécessaire pour la conformité à ces standards.

Support de validation par schéma. XML supporte les schémas XSD qui définissent strictement et valident la structure des données. Convertir JSON en XML permet la validation par schéma que JSON Schema n'égale pas en adoption d'entreprise.

Quand garder JSON plutôt : Pour les APIs REST, applications web et microservices modernes, JSON est le standard. XML est plus verbeux et plus lourd. Ne convertissez en XML que si le système destinataire le requiert.

EnConvert génère du XML bien formé côté serveur. L'offre gratuite supporte 100 conversions par mois sans inscription.

JSON vs XML

Caractéristique JSON XML
Syntaxe Accolades, crochets Tags d'ouverture et fermeture
Verbosité Compact Verbeux (2-3x plus grand)
Types de données Chaînes, nombres, booléens, null, tableaux, objets Tout est texte (types via schéma)
Validation par schéma JSON Schema (adoption croissante) XSD (standard industriel)
Commentaires Non supportés Supportés (<!-- -->)
Attributs Pas de concept d'attributs Les éléments peuvent avoir des attributs
Espaces de noms Non supportés Support complet des namespaces
Standard API APIs REST APIs SOAP
Idéal pour Web moderne, APIs REST, JavaScript Systèmes d'entreprise, SOAP, industries régulées

Questions fréquentes

Oui. La sortie inclut une déclaration XML appropriée, un élément racine et des éléments enfants correctement imbriqués. Les caractères spéciaux sont correctement échappés. La sortie passe les validateurs XML standards.

Les tableaux JSON sont convertis en éléments XML répétés avec le même nom de tag. Par exemple, {"items": ["a", "b", "c"]} devient <items><item>a</item><item>b</item><item>c</item></items>.

Oui. Les objets JSON imbriqués sont convertis en éléments XML imbriqués, préservant toute la hiérarchie. La profondeur d'imbrication n'est pas limitée.

L'offre gratuite accepte les fichiers JSON jusqu'à 5 Mo avec 100 conversions par mois — sans inscription ni carte bancaire. Le plan Starter (19 $/mois) supporte 2 000 conversions avec limite de 15 Mo par fichier, le Pro (49 $/mois) 10 000 conversions avec 50 Mo, et le Business (149 $/mois) 50 000 conversions avec 150 Mo.

Oui. L'API EnConvert supporte la conversion programmatique pour les pipelines d'intégration d'entreprise. Envoyez du JSON via l'API REST et recevez la sortie XML. Exemples d'intégration disponibles en Python, JavaScript et cURL.

Intégrer via l'API

Automatisez les conversions JSON vers XML dans votre application en quelques lignes de code.

curl -X POST "https://api.enconvert.com/v1/convert/json-to-xml" \
  -H "X-API-Key: sk_YOUR_SECRET_KEY" \
  -F "file=@input_file" \
  -o output_file